The invention discloses a variable-pitch coaxial oil-driven six-rotor helicopter. The variable-pitch coaxial oil-driven six-rotor helicopter comprises a coaxial rotor-operating system, a power system-transmission system and a frame system, wherein the coaxial rotor-operating system and the power system-transmission system are mounted on the frame system. According to the invention, problems of the low load, short endurance, poor wind resistance and the like in the traditional electric multi-rotor helicopter are mainly solved; and problems of high purchase, use and maintenance cost, high use and maintenance technical threshold and the like caused by complicated mechanical structure, structural dynamic characteristic, flight dynamical characteristic, aerodynamic characteristics and flight control system in the traditional helicopter are also solved.
